Abstract

Desmoid tumors or aggressive fibromatosis are locally aggressive benign tumors. These arise anywhere in the body but are commonly seen in the anterior abdominal wall. The main treatment choices are continuous surveillance, adjuvant chemotherapy, surgery, and postoperative chemotherapy. However, where needs arise, surgery may be done, specifically wide local excision with adequate clearance. In our case report we show a case of a male patient presenting with umbilical hernia and an incidental discovery of a desmoid tumor that was closely proximate to the herniated sac. The plan of action planned were sac excision followed by tumor excision and then anatomical repair, that is, umbilical herniorrhaphy and postoperative chemotherapy.
